Accuracy/Reproducibility Protocol:

Using a iM01 My Weigh Hich Precision Scale

AFTER CALIBRATION

  1. Use a liquid with a known density (water) to test this.
  2. Put some water in the syringe.
  3. Push out 5mL of water onto a scale. Record the mass in grams.
  4. Repeat step 3 nine more times.
  5. Calculate the volume of water that came out each trial. (Volume = Mass/Density)
  6. Compare each trial the volume of each trial to 5mL. Reproducibility = Actual/Theoretical x 100%
